The SN74AC533PWRE4 is a high-performance integrated circuit designed and manufactured by the renowned Texas Instruments. This device is a part of the 'AC series, which is well-known for its exceptional speed and low power consumption characteristics. The SN74AC533PWRE4 is particularly notable for its functionality as an octal transparent D-type latch with 3-state outputs.
Key Features
- Logic Type: The device operates as an octal transparent D-type latch, which is essential for temporary data storage and transferring data within a system.
- Output Type: It features 3-state outputs, which means that in addition to the standard high and low logic levels, there is a third "high impedance" state that effectively removes the output from the circuit.
- Package: The SN74AC533PWRE4 comes in a TSSOP (Thin Shrink Small Outline Package) which is ideal for space-constrained applications.
- Pin Count: The device has a 20-pin configuration, allowing for sufficient I/O options while maintaining a compact footprint.
